[sql] 복구된 데이터의 일관성 검증 방법

데이터베이스에서 데이터 손상 또는 손실을 방지하기 위해 복구된 데이터의 일관성을 검증하는 것은 매우 중요합니다. 복구된 데이터의 일관성 검증을 위해 다음과 같은 방법을 사용할 수 있습니다.

1. 체크섬 검사

체크섬은 데이터 블록이나 파일의 일관성과 무결성을 확인하는 데 사용됩니다. 데이터베이스에서는 복구된 데이터의 블록 또는 파일에 대한 체크섬을 생성하여 기존 데이터와 비교하여 일관성을 확인할 수 있습니다.

CHECKSUM TABLE 테이블명;

2. 무결성 제약 조건 확인

복구된 데이터에는 초기에 설정된 무결성 제약 조건을 준수해야 합니다. 이를 확인하기 위해 데이터베이스 시스템은 무결성 제약 조건을 검사하고, 오류가 발견될 경우 해당 데이터를 수정하거나 복구해야 합니다.

3. 데이터 무결성 검사

데이터 무결성을 확인하여 중복, 누락 또는 다른 문제를 식별할 수 있습니다. SQL 쿼리를 사용하여 데이터 무결성을 검사하고 오류가 발견된 경우 조치를 취해야 합니다.

CHECK CONSTRAINT 모든;

데이터 일관성 검증은 데이터베이스의 정확성과 무결성을 보장하며, 데이터 복구 프로세스의 중요한 부분입니다.


참고문헌: